This second edition of Human Rights Politics and Practice practice a comprehensive overview of human rights that introduces students to a range of theoretical issues and practical approaches Bringing together leading international experts on human rights this expanded fully revised and updated edition is ideal for students of human rights at undergraduate and postgraduate level
